What is a Web-Server?
What is a Web-Server?
A web server is a crucial component of the internet , responsible for delivering web content to users. At its core, a web server is a software application or hardware device that stores, processes, and serves website files to clients, typically through a web browser. When a user enters a URL or clicks on a link, their browser sends a request to the web server hosting the desired content. The server then processes this request and responds by sending the appropriate files, such as HTML documents, images, and scripts, back to the user’s browser for display.
Web servers operate using the Hypertext Transfer Protocol (HTTP), which defines how messages are formatted and transmitted. This protocol allows for the seamless exchange of information between clients and servegs. In addition to serving static content, many web servers can also handle dynamic content generated by server-side scripts, enabling more interactive and personalized user experiences. Popular web server software includes Apache, Nginx, and Microsoft Internet Information Services (IIS), each offering unique features and capabilities to cater to different needs.

Choosing the Right Technology
Popular Web-Server Software Options
When selecting web-server software, it is crucial to consider the specific needs of your organization. Different technologies offer varying levels of performance, scalability, and security. A well-chosen server can enhance operational efficiency and reduce costs. This is vital for maintaining a competitive edge. The right choice can lead to significant financial savings.
For instance, Apache HTTP Server is renowned for its flexibility and extensive module support. It allows for customization to meet diverse requirements. This adaptability can be a game-changer for businesses with unique needs. In contrast, Nginx is often favored for its high performance and low resource consumption. It excels in handling concurrent connections, which is essential for high-traffic websites. Efficiency matters in today’s digital landscape.
Moreover, Microsoft’s Internet Information Services (IIS) integrates seamlessly with Windows environments. This can streamline operations for organizations already invested in Microsoft technologies. Testing and Troubleshooting
Common Issues and Solutions
When managing a web server, various issues may arise that can impact performance and accessibility. For instance, connectivity problems can often stem from misconfigured network settings. Identifying the root cause is essential for effective resolution. A quick check can save time.
Additionally, server overload can lead to slow response times. This situation often occurs when traffic exceeds the server’s capacity. Monitoring traffic patterns can provide valuable insights. Understanding usage trends is crucial for planning.
Another common issue involves software compatibility. Sometimes, updates to server software can conflict with existing applications. This can lead to unexpected downtime. Regular compatibility checks are advisable. They help maintain operational integrity.
In terms of troubleshooting, utilizing diagnostic tools can significantly aid in identifying issues. Tools such ws ping and traceroute can help pinpoint connectivity problems. These tools are invaluable for network diagnostics. They provide clear data.
Moreover, reviewing server logs can reveal underlying issues that may not be immediately apparent. Logs often contain error messages that can guide troubleshooting efforts. Analyzing logs is a best practice. It can uncover hidden problems.
